Overview
CWWDL 14639 is a poorly populated, moderately dense object of high C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a close distance, near the mid-plane. It is catalogued as a near-solar metallicity, very young cluster (see Parameters). It was recently reported in the literature.
â ī¸ Warning: This is likely a duplicate object, which shares a large percentage of members with at least one previously reported entry. See table with shared members information.
